Fully vaccinated. Question/clarification for travel from USA to India via Japan:

1. Any COVID-19 testing required for transit through Japan? Flying Jun 13 on Japan Airlines SFO - NRT (Tokyo, Narita), and within 2 hours NRT (Tokyo, Narita) - BLR.

Thanks in advance
No. Transit passengers aren't tested or asked to show proof. You only need to worry about the entry requirements for India. You probably already know those, but from what I remember Americans who preupload their vax information before journey don't need to take a predeparture test.
